1 serving of bacon and eggs with cherry tomatoes contains 329 Calories. The macronutrient breakdown is 6% carbs, 70% fat, and 24% protein. This is a good source of protein (35% of your Daily Value), potassium (10% of your Daily Value), and vitamin a (25% of your Daily Value).

Directions
- Fry the bacon in a skillet over medium-high heat until crispy. Set aside.
- Use the same pan to fry the eggs and halved cherry tomatoes with remaining bacon grease. Cook eggs as you prefer.
